Satan's Stop Signs – A Fun Bible Object Lesson for Your Kids There's a saying that goes "the devil made me do it." I don't think this is right or more importantly biblical. If we sin, we do it on our own. However, I think it would be correct to say, "the devil tried to make me not do it" – whatever "it" may be. 1 Thessalonians 2:18 says this: "Satan hindered us." Your kids need to be aware of this enemy and his different ploys to try and get them off track. Here is a fun Bible object lesson to help teach this important truth.Here's what you do:The object you will use for this lesson will be a stop sign. You can print a picture of one off of the Internet, laminate it and place it on a paint stick.Ask the following questions to help stimulate discussion:1. What am I holding up? (Hold up the stop sign and wait for a response.) You're right. It's a stop sign.2. What are stop signs for? (Wait for responses.)3. Most of the time stop signs are used to protect us.
